Technical Specifications

Side-by-side comparison of GeForce GTX 980 (móvel) and RadeonT 780M

NVIDIA

GeForce GTX 980 (móvel)

The GeForce GTX 980 (móvel) is manufactured by NVIDIA. It was released in September 21 2015. It features the Maxwell 2.0 architecture. The core clock ranges from 1064 MHz to 1216 MHz. It has 2048 shading units. The thermal design power (TDP) is 100W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 7,366 points. Launch price was $395.82.

AMD

RadeonT 780M

The RadeonT 780M is manufactured by AMD. It was released in January 31 2024. It features the RDNA 3.0 architecture. The core clock ranges from 800 MHz to 2900 MHz. It has 768 shading units. The thermal design power (TDP) is 15W. Manufactured using 4 nm process technology. It features 12 dedicated ray tracing cores for enhanced lighting effects. G3D Mark benchmark score: 7,098 points.
